Exam sub-board local rules: 2022/23

The Sub-Board of Examiners can set additional criteria for the award of Merit/Distinction. The Sub-Board of Examiners can also designate a course or courses as being critical to assessment for a programme and establish 'local rules' where the specific course(s) and/or marks will be given special consideration in the awarding of the degree.

The following programmes do not have any Exam Sub-Board 'local rules'. For the programme(s) below the award of the degree is determined by the relevant classification scheme.
